Sea urchin cream pasta bar dinner in Gongdeok, Seoul: Orot Robata

In short

Orot Robata is a Japanese dining bar on the first floor of Gongdeok Park Xi in Mapo, Seoul, listed in the Blue Ribbon Survey for six years running. Arriving at 5:30pm with a coworker, we took bar seats for sea urchin cream pasta and tomato kaisen nabe with added fresh noodles, the smoky char from the grilled vegetables making the broth especially memorable. Beyond expectations: tomato kaisen nabe

For our second dish, we debated between motsu nabe and tomato kaisen nabe (seafood hot pot), and went with the tomato kaisen nabe. And what a genius move that was! A pot brimming with rich tomato broth, topped with fresh tomatoes and a mix of ingredients, drew a gasp the second it arrived.

The eggplant and zucchini seemed to have been grilled over open flame before going in, because that subtle smoky char was absolutely the best. Loaded with shrimp, baby octopus, clams and more, the broth was so rich and bursting with umami.

The smoky char from the grilled vegetables soaked into the tomato broth and seafood, taking the flavor up another notch.

Tomato kaisen nabe filled with seafood and grilled vegetables

We added fresh noodles to it, and thanks to the rich broth, it turned into a gorgeous pasta all on its own! Getting to enjoy both the deep flavor of the nabe and a fresh noodle pasta was the best two-in-one choice.
